POJ1061 青蛙的约会(扩展欧几里得)题解
Description
我们把这两只青蛙分别叫做青蛙A和青蛙B,并且规定纬度线上东经0度处为原点,由东往西为正方向,单位长度1米,这样我们就得到了一条首尾相接的数轴。设青蛙A的出发点坐标是x,青蛙B的出发点坐标是y。青蛙A一次能跳m米,青蛙B一次能跳n米,两只青蛙跳一次所花费的时间相同。纬度线总长L米。现在要你求出它们跳了几次以后才会碰面。
Input
Output
Sample Input
1 2 3 4 5
Sample Output
4
思路:
扩展欧几里得算法是用来求解 a*x+b*y==c ( c==k*gcd(a,b) )
贴一下exgcd
代码:
转载于:https://www.cnblogs.com/KirinSB/p/9408785.html
POJ1061 青蛙的约会(扩展欧几里得)题解相关推荐
- POJ 1061 青蛙的约会 (扩展欧几里得)
青蛙的约会 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 97673 Accepted: 18409 Descripti ...
- POJ - 1061 青蛙的约会(扩展欧几里得)
题目链接:点击查看 题目大意:两只青蛙在一个单向循环数轴上跳动,给出初始位置和每秒跳动的距离以及数轴长度,问是否可以相遇,若能相遇求出最小时间 题目分析:自从第一次接触扩展欧几里得以来已经有半年时间了 ...
- JZYZOJ1371 青蛙的约会 扩展欧几里得 GTMD数论
http://172.20.6.3/Problem_Show.asp?id=1371 题意是两个青蛙朝同一个方向跳 http://www.cnblogs.com/jackge/archive/2013 ...
- bzoj 1477 青蛙的约会 拓展欧几里得(详细解析)
大水题: 题目戳这里:http://www.lydsy.com/JudgeOnline/problem.php?id=1477 这道题我们分析在一个数轴上有两只青蛙,这个数轴是首尾交接的,所以可以一直 ...
- J - 青蛙的约会(扩展欧几里得)
https://vjudge.net/contest/218366#problem/J 第一步追及公式要写对:y+nk-(x+mk)=pL => (n-m)k+lp=x-y 可以看出扩展欧几里得 ...
- POJ1061 青蛙的约会【扩展欧几里得算法】
青蛙的约会 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 126746 Accepted: 27392 Descript ...
- poj-青蛙的约会(扩展欧几里得)nyoj-小柯的约会
由题意可列出方程 x + m * s - (y + n * s) = k * l; 化简得 (n-m)*s + k*l = x - y 化简得 (n-m)*s = x - y (mod l); ...
- 欧几里得定理与扩展欧几里得定理
欧几里的定理(辗转相除法): gcd(a,b) = gcd(b,a%b) gcd(a,b)表示a,b的最大公约数 证明: 设 a > b c = a%b a = k * b + c (k为某个整 ...
- 求解线性同余方程--扩展欧几里得
资料来源:https://blog.csdn.net/ //求解ax=b(mod m) 返回0为无解,否则返回gcd(a,m)个mod m意义下的解,用X[]存 int mod(int a, int ...
- 欧几里得 扩展欧几里得
欧几里得 & 扩展欧几里得 时间复杂度T(n):O(log2n); 空间复杂度S(n):O(n); Advantages: 1. 时间复杂度不高,和普通欧几里得一样: 2. 代 ...
最新文章
- sql数据库常见命令总结
- In English or Chinese?
- [导入]毕业的大学生的100条忠告
- 海信计算机辅助统,海信计算机辅助手术系统将覆盖山东三级医院
- 将Java EE与jOOQ结合使用的初学者指南
- 【C语言进阶深度学习记录】六 C语言中的分支语句
- [转人工智能工程师学习路线及具备的5项基本技能
- ECCV18 Oral | CornerNet目标检测开启预测“边界框”到预测“点对”的新思路
- 建立一个Shape类,有Circle(圆形)和Rect(矩形)子类
- 卡巴斯基终生免费使用方法
- 机器学习 高维数据可视化
- python脚本王者荣耀自动刷金币
- 2021北京家庭摇号官网信息汇总
- 【LLS-Player】webrtc m94 修改
- javax.crypto.Cipher线程安全问题
- 网站设计的好坏对宣传的效果的影响!
- 解释一下label中的写法:plt.plot(t, sig, b-, linewidth=2, label=r$\sigma(t) = \frac{1}{1 + e^{-t}}$)...
- 数字后端基本概念介绍——Pin Blockage
- 以下关于android应用程序的目录结构,以下关于Android应用程序的目录结构描述中,错误的是哪个()...
- 电脑开机后鼠标右键点击桌面图标反应很慢,要等上1分钟左右右键内容才能出来怎么办?
热门文章
- Eclipse中的Git使用之Branch创建,Merge
- SFTP连接服务器后,PWD显示的目录、是用户的home目录
- ITA结合测试(总结之六:ITA上的时间,与本地时间)
- 【Hive】命令行提示符中显示当前所在数据库
- 【MySQL】源码安装MySQL
- Mysql插入中文的字段内容时乱码的解决方法
- C# WebApi Xml序列化问题解决方法:“ObjectContent`1”类型未能序列化内容类型“application/xml;charset=utf-8“的响应正文。...
- Android Studio support 26.0.0-alpha1 Failed to resolve: com.android.support:appcompat-v7:27.+ 报错解决方法
- 关于json返回日期格式化的解决方案
- 安装vim提示Depends: libpython3.5 (>= 3.5.0~b1) but it is not going to be installed的解决方法